George Jones death spikes sales

George Jones death spikes sales

Posted 11:45 AM 5/3/2013 by Joe Bevans

LOS ANGELES (AP) - George Jones has hit chart records in death that he never did when he was alive. Billboard reports Jones' 1998 release "16 Biggest Hits" is number 42 on the Billboard 200 chart. Jones never hit higher than number 53 on the Billboard 200, with "Cold Hard Truth" in 1999. Jones also sold 149,000 digital downloads in the past week. That's more than he sold in all of 2013 before his death, with 91,000.
